The question was "can", and yeah, if you are online, Nintendo can one day identify you and take you out.

If you want to run *any* mods online regardless, the question instead is "will they?" Recent bans seem to be connected to either NSPs, traces of XCIs, save editing, or cheating online. So overclocking, Retroarch and the like is probably safe from now, but of course things can change at any point.

Ban Risk according to Atmosphere devs:

Instant ban:
• Piracy of any sort
• Homebrew nsps
• Changing user icon through homebrew
• Sketchy eShop behavior

Not so instant ban, but still a ban:
• Modding online games, except in very niche circumstances
• Cheating in online games
• Clearing error logs after they've been uploaded to Nintendo (this may extend to using both emummc and sysmmc online, due to mismatched logs)

Not a ban, so far:
• Atmosphere itself
• Homebrew
• Custom themes
• Custom sysmodules (sys-ftpd-light, etc.)
• Mods/cheating in offline games
• Overclocking with sys-clk (just don't do it competitively, for all of our sakes)
• emummc

We just don't know enough yet:
• Screwing with PRODINFO, but NOT committing bannable offenses
• Using the experimental PRODINFO dummying included in Atmosphere 0.11.2 and later.
